Instructions
Preheat oven and skillet
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Place a cast-iron skillet in the oven as it preheats.
Pro tip: Preheating the skillet helps form a crispy crust on the cornbread.
Mix dry ingredients
In a large bowl, whisk together the cornmeal, all-purpose fl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
Combine wet ingredients
In a separate bowl, mix the buttermilk, beaten eggs, and melted butter.
Pro tip: Ensure the melted butter is slightly cooled to avoid cooking the eggs.
Combine wet and dry mixtures
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until just combined.
Pro tip: Do not overmix to keep the cornbread tender.
Add mix-ins
Fold in the shredded cheddar cheese, corn kernels, and chopped jalapeño until evenly distributed.
Pro tip: Adjust the amount of jalapeño based on your spice preference.
Bake the cornbread
Carefully remove the hot skillet from the oven and grease it lightly. Pour the batter into the skillet and return it to the oven.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the top is golden and a toothpick inserted into the centre comes out clean.
Cool before serving
Allow the cornbread to cool in the skillet for about 10 minutes before slicing and serving.
Pro tip: Cooling slightly helps the cornbread hold its shape when sliced.
